Subcutaneous Injection
A method of administering medication under the skin into the fatty tissue layer between the skin and the muscle.
Stethoscope
A medical instrument used for listening to sounds produced within the body, particularly the heart and lungs, in order to diagnose conditions.
Body Sounds
The noises produced within the body that can be heard during a medical examination, such as heartbeats or lung sounds.
Examination Light
A focused light source used in medical settings to illuminate the examination area for clearer observation.
